Number: 137865572
Country: Pakistan
Source: RFQ
Number: 137865642
Number: 137865722
Number: 137865867
Number: 137865906
Source: Made-in-china
Number: 137866095
Number: 137866130
Number: 137866259
Number: 137866323
Number: 137866331
Number: 137866359
Number: 137866439
Number: 137866930
Number: 137866947
Number: 137867107
Number: 137867147
Number: 137867208
Number: 137867387
Number: 137867522
Number: 137867827
Number: 137867871